The Royal Livingstone
is a 5* resort located within the Mosi-oa-Tunya National Park on the Zambian
side of the Zambezi River, enjoying prospects over the Zambezi River and
the falls shared by no other hotel in the Victoria Falls region.

The
bedrooms are two-storey clusters inspired by the grand estate houses
of a bygone era. Each cluster comprises 10 en-suite air conditioned
rooms with private balconies and terraces that offer spectacular
views of the great river and beyond.Each room offers a quiet retreat
from the uggedness of Africa, with large shaded verandas and open
spaces cooled by swirling fans and tall shutters. The travellers bar and
lounge is a place where guests can relax under thatched shade, decorated
in harmonious greens, creams and ebony. |
With
its comfortable armchairs and low ottomans the lounge is a place to enjoy
an impeccably served high tea or to linger longer over some fine
port or cigar. The a la carte restaurant will serve a range of exquisite
delicacies from around the world.

DAY
VISITOR CENTRE
Located
near the main road and in close proximity of the Zambezi Sun, this facility
caters for day visitors to the Falls. The centre provides access
to quick and easy booking for adventure activities such as white
water rafting and bungee jumping. The less adventurous might like
to choose from sundowner cruises, game
drives,
bird watching and cycling safaris. |

The Zambezi Sun
is a 3* resort located nearby. The architecture was inspired by the timeless
African tradition, and its unique styling will offer visitors the
experience of truly being at the heart of Africa. The hotel has the feel
of a walled city, centuries old. It is comprised of open, organic
buildings in earthy colours with rambling clusters of rooms, punctuated
by chimneys and towers. |
| The
212 guest rooms are low-slung, open and airy. Each one spills out
onto a cool landscaped pool area, while the restaurant and bar are focused
around the central pool.The two-storey en-suite rooms have private balconies
that welcome the morning sun. Amenities include independent
air-conditioning, satellite TV, fold-out couches, safe and telephone.
The central reception area houses a family-friendly , high quality
buffet restaurant, a pool bar and a lively alfresco grill and entertainment
area. |
